Louise Redknapp appeared to be in good form despite rumours that her marriage had ended, as she celebrated her son Charles’ 13th birthday this week.

 

“Happy birthday to my big boy who gets totally embarrassed about having his pic done with his mum in front of his mates,” Louise wrote on Instagram, alongside a snap of herself and Charles.

 

Louise attempted to make Charles smile in the photo, while dad Jamie was nowhere to be seen.

 

It’s believed Louise has moved out of the family home in Oxshott, Surrey; however, she was around to mark the couple’s eldest son’s big birthday.

Recently, The Sun reported that Jamie and Louise had called it a day on their 19-year marriage; however, there has been no official statement from the couple yet.

 

A source said: “Louise told one of her closest friends she and Jamie had split. Louise was quite open about the fact the relationship was over.

 

“She mentioned how much time they had spent apart and that, when she and Jamie had tried to spend time together, it hadn’t been good.

 

“It’s a very difficult situation because of their two children, who they are both determined to protect. That’s why they’re not prepared to officially end the marriage or comment publicly.

 

“They hope time apart might fix things, even though that doesn’t look likely.”

The former Eternal singer has two children with the retired footballer; Charles, 13, and Beau, eight.

 

Shortly after the rumours emerged, Louise was seen partying with her close pal, model Daisy Lowe, whom she met when they both competed on Strictly Come Dancing.

 

Louise’s Strictly Come Dancing pal Karen Clifton appeared to confirm the split when she told The Sun that the mum-of-two was “reinventing” herself.

 

She said: "On the show, Louise grew in confidence and you could see her wings expanding. It's been great because she's been a stay-at-home mum and sometimes you can forget about yourself.
